本课程主要讲解有关网络爬虫的基础知识以及实战的综合应用

*   01 HTTP的概念以及request请求头各个参数的学习/

  *   01 讲解http协议的访问流程.mp4 01:08

  *   02 http协议tcp的三次握手+http与https的区别.mp4 15:00

  *   03 常见的网络结构有哪些层.mp4 15:00

  *   04 http协议请求报文包括哪几部分.mp4 15:00

  *   05 http协议常见头部参数的详细说明+Accept.mp4 15:00

  *   06 http协议常见头部参数:Refer+User-agent.mp4 15:00

  *   07 通过python项目的代码来了解各个头部参数.mp4 15:00

  *   08 通过程序来了解user-agent等反爬技术的应用.mp4 10:00

*   02 同一IP频繁访问的限制以及爬虫伪装及反爬技术及响应报文的参数/

  *   01 在Django框架加入对同一个IP频繁访问的限制.mp4 15:00

  *   02 讲解爬虫伪装的几种方法.mp4 15:00

  *   03 讲解爬虫伪装的几种方法及通过案例实现反爬.mp4 15:00

  *   04 通过user-agent在项目中实现反爬的功能.mp4 15:00

  *   05 通过user-agent在项目中实现反爬功能(二).mp4 15:00

  *   06 分析如何把IP地址记录下来及查看访问的频率.mp4 15:00

  *   07 程序统计哪些IP频繁访问并且nginx的配置.mp4 15:00

  *   08 整个功能通过项目完整实现.mp4 08:35

*   03 讲解requests模块中API方法及通过实战案例具体应用且/

  *   01 讲解requests模块中get/post爬取网络数据.mp4 15:00

  *   02 requests中apparent_encoding及接收数.mp4 15:00

  *   03 requests中Cookie的学习以及通过案例来应用.mp4 15:00

  *   04 requests中代理的应用及自己搭建代码服务器.mp4 15:00

  *   05 linux系统中如何搭建代理服务器.mp4 15:00

  *   06 创建代理池,项目访问时更换代理IP.mp4 15:00

  *   07 创建代理池,项目访问时更换代理IP(二).mp4 08:00

  *   08 响应数据以及制定头信息.mp4 15:00

*   04 具体讲解lxml模块以及XPath常用的规则以及在项目中如何/

  *   01 讲解里lxml模块的含义以及如何安装lxml.mp4 15:00

  *   02 XPath的常用规则及在项目中实际应用(一).mp4 15:00

  *   03 XPath的常用规则及在项目中实际应用(二).mp4 15:00

  *   04 XPath的常用规则及在项目中实际应用(三).mp4 15:00

  *   05 XPath的常用规则及在项目中实际应用(四).mp4 21:00

*   05 实战项目来实现原生代码如何网络爬取数据的:获取下厨房中图片/

  *   01 复习前面的知识点:requests中的API方法.mp4 15:00

  *   02 复习有关xpath的常用规则的应用.mp4 15:00

  *   03 创建python项目及封装requests爬取数据方法.mp4 15:00

  *   04 封装写入错误日志的函数.mp4 15:00

  *   05 封装解析食品分类数据的函数及在项目中加入.mp4 15:00

  *   06 通过xpath规则获取分类图片及获取每页数据.mp4 15:00

  *   07 封装函数:把图片数据保存到图片文件中.mp4 15:00

  *   08 封装函数:图片数据保存到图片文件中(二).mp4 15:00

  *   09 项目的整体测试以及查缺补漏.mp4 14:13

*   06 讲解多线程以及队列在爬虫项目中的应用/

  *   01 补充上节课案例的功能以及开始多线程的讲解.mp4 15:00

  *   02 讲解进程和线程的区别以及实际应用.mp4 15:00

  *   03 讲解Thread类中常见的属性和方法.mp4 15:00

  *   04 创建多个子线程以及是如何在项目中运行的.mp4 15:00

  *   05 创建一个继承Thread类的类来创建多个子线程.mp4 15:00

  *   06 线程锁以及重点简介队列.mp4 15:00

  *   07 三种队列:先进先出,现金后出,优先级队列.mp4 15:00

  *   08 创建进程一个线程队列中加数据另一个取数据.mp4 15:00

  *   09 讲解队列中join的用法.mp4 13:38

*   07 通过获取所有大学的校名以及学校的简介来巩固多线程爬取数据/

  *   01 搭建项目的整体结构.mp4 14:57

  *   02 封装函数:获取大学数据及解析大学数据.mp4 15:00

  *   03 创建一个线程实现把大学数据获取且放入队列.mp4 15:00

  *   04 创建多个线程从队列中再读取数据.mp4 15:00

*   08 下载安装scrapy框架以及通过scrapy.spider类/

  *   01 scrapy框架的介绍以及如何下载安装.mp4 15:00

  *   02 创建继承scrapy.spider类的爬虫类实现爬取.mp4 15:00

  *   03 通过实际爬取一个网络数据来应用scrapy.mp4 15:00

  *   04 通过实际爬取一个网络数据来应用scrapy.mp4 14:15

*   09 创建scrapy框架以及讲解scrapy框架中各个元素/

  *   01 复习前面的知识点.mp4 15:00

  *   02 讲解如何通过命令行来创建scrapy框架.mp4 15:00

  *   03 讲解scrapy框架中的一些配置参数的含义.mp4 15:00

  *   04 分析scrapy框架的底层代码的实现流程.mp4 15:00

  *   05 通过一个实际案例来熟悉如何通过scrapy框架.mp4 15:00

  *   06 讲解scrapy框架中item以及pipline管道.mp4 15:00

  *   07 讲解Pipline管道的实际应用以及数据的处理.mp4 15:00

  *   08 梳理整体框架结构中各个对象的含义.mp4 12:52

*   10 通过爬取网络中大学的名称和简介来学习scrapy框架/

  *   01 复习前面知识点.mp4 15:00

  *   02 复习前面知识点(二).mp4 15:00

  *   03 梳理scrapy框架中各个部分的功能.mp4 15:00

  *   04 通过案例爬取大学数据来巩固框架的使用.mp4 15:00

  *   05 书写整个爬取数据的过程.mp4 15:00

  *   06 书写整个爬取数据的过程(二).mp4 15:00

  *   07 书写整个爬取数据的过程(三).mp4 15:00

  *   08 创建管道pipline把获取的数据存储到数据库.mp4 21:00

  *   09 在管道中优化把数据写入数据库的代码(一).mp4 15:00

  *   10 在管道中优化把数据写入数据库的代码(二).mp4 15:00

*   11 梳理scrapy架构及各个中间件机制/

  *   01 解决上面案例出现的bug.mp4 15:00

  *   02 创建虚拟环境以及终端测试:scrapy shell.mp4 15:00

  *   03 讲解scrapy框架的运行机制:各个环节的关系.mp4 15:00

  *   04 讲解Scrapy的信号 是如何工作的.mp4 15:00

  *   05 在爬虫类中创建侦听各种信号的方法.mp4 15:00

  *   06 讲解scrapy框架中的内置的中间件(二).mp4 22:54

  *   07 讲解scrapy框架中的内置的中间件.mp4 15:00